We are currently hiring for an exciting opportunity as an Intern (m/f/d) – Software Engineer to join our Generative 3D MODSIM R&D team at Dassault Systèmes.

As part of our CATIA Function Driven Generative Design and SIMULIA Structural Generative Engineer portfolios, you will contribute to the integration of AI-based surrogate models to accelerate the design process and enhance simulation performance. Working alongside experienced engineers and researchers, you will gain hands-on experience at the intersection of machine learning and multiphysics simulation, helping ensure Dassault Systèmes remains a technological leader in generative design.

Role Description & Responsibilities

  • You will research, design, and implement AI-driven methods for structural optimization and simulation, advancing next-generation generative engineering capabilities
  • You will translate user and product management requirements into clear functional specifications and actionable development plans
  • You will collaborate with cross-functional teams to define, design, and deliver innovative software features within our engineering simulation portfolio
  • You will develop, code, and test advanced algorithms in C++, Python, or similar languages, ensuring robustness and scalability
  • You will ensure smooth integration, maintenance, and continuous performance optimization within the broader product ecosystem

You will stay at the forefront of emerging trends in finite element analysis, optimization, and AI applications in engineering, contributing to knowledge sharing within a globally distributed R&D team

Qualifications

  • Ideally, a completed bachelor’s degree in mathematics, computer science, mechanical engineering or similar areas of study
  • First experience with Computer-Aided Engineering (CAE) & Finite Element Methods (FEM) in theory as well as preferably in practice
  • Understanding and knowledge in mechanics, mathematics, and/or artificial intelligence architecture such as surrogate models
  • Programming skills in Python, C++ or Fortran are advantageous
  • Fascination for (simulation-based) optimization
  • Very good English language skills in speaking and writing, German language skills are advantageous

Wichtiges für Werkstudierende

Was dieses Praktikum im Bereich Tech in Karlsruhe für dich bedeutet: die Vergütungsregeln, die Sozialabgaben und worauf internationale Studierende achten sollten.

Wochenstunden

Praktika haben keine 20-Stunden-Grenze, ein freiwilliges Praktikum über drei Monate muss aber in der Regel mindestens den Mindestlohn zahlen. Pflichtpraktika im Studium sind davon ausgenommen.

Sozialabgaben

Pflichtpraktika sind weitgehend von Sozialabgaben befreit. Freiwillige Praktika gelten ab einer gewissen Dauer als reguläre Beschäftigung, dann fallen meist Beiträge an.

Internationale Studierende

Studierende von außerhalb der EU dürfen 140 volle oder 280 halbe Tage im Jahr arbeiten (seit März 2024, zuvor 120/240). Ein Werkstudentenvertrag passt meist in diesen Rahmen — prüfe die genauen Grenzen auf deinem Aufenthaltstitel.
